Getting Ketamine For Melancholy
Ketamine for despair is available in a number of kinds. The one one which the FDA has approved as being a medication for melancholy is often a nasal spray called esketamine (Spravato). It’s for Older people who either haven’t been aided by antidepressant products, have significant depressive problem, or are suicidal. They continue on on their own antidepressant and get esketamine at a health care provider’s office or inside a clinic, in which a overall health treatment company watches in excess of them for 2 hrs after the dose.
For procedure-resistant despair, clients commonly receive the nasal spray two times every week for 1 to four months; then the moment every week for weeks 5 to nine; and afterwards the moment just about every week or 2 following that. The spray provides a “black box” warning about the potential risk of sedation and hassle with awareness, judgment, and contemplating, and also threat for abuse or misuse from the drug and suicidal views and behaviors.
Other sorts of ketamine for depression not authorised because of the FDA for mental health and fitness problems contain IV infusion, a shot in the arm, or lozenges. Most exploration seems to be at ketamine given by IV. You could only get it by IV or shot in a doctor’s Office environment. Some Medical doctors will prescribe lozenges for at-home use — typically to maintain melancholy at bay concerning infusions.

Ketamine is generally considered safe, including for people who are experiencing suicidal ideation (views or options for suicide). The key Negative effects are dissociation, intoxication, sedation, significant blood pressure level, dizziness, headache, blurred eyesight, stress, nausea, and vomiting. Ketamine is averted or made use of with extreme caution in the subsequent teams:
• those with a heritage of psychosis or schizophrenia, as You can find concern the dissociation ketamine creates will make psychotic Ailments worse
• individuals with a background of compound use problem, simply because ketamine could potentially cause euphoria (very likely by triggering the opioid receptors) and many people could become addicted to it (which is referred to as ketamine use problem)
• teenagers, as there are numerous problems with regard to the lengthy-time period outcomes of ketamine around the nonetheless-producing adolescent Mind
• people who are pregnant or breastfeeding

Other brain outcomes of ketamine for depression
Ketamine may go in other approaches within the Mind, also. Some nerve cells (neurons) in the Mind involved in mood use a chemical (neurotransmitter) termed glutamate to communicate with one another. The nerve cells want glutamate receptors visualize them like catcher’s mitts for glutamate in an effort to ketamine for depression join With this communication.
From the brains of some people with melancholy, Those people nerve cells don’t get so fired up by glutamate any more. It’s as When the glutamate receptors the catcher’s mitts are deactivated or weakened.
But immediately after people with this distinct trouble obtain ketamine, All those nerve mobile connections get restocked with new glutamate receptors. It’s as if ketamine will help make new catcher’s mitts with the glutamate, so that the nerve cells can respond to it once again.
